What Makes ICE1 Different
Belt-Drive System
A belt physically isolates the motor from the platter, so motor vibration never reaches your stylus. Manual 33/45 RPM switching,
upgraded belt, and consistent tension for reliable, quiet rotation year after year.
Adjustable Counterweight
Dial in the exact tracking force your cartridge needs, 3.5g for the pre-installed ATN-3600L. Proper balance means less record wear and a cleaner, more accurate signal from the very first groove. What this means for you: your records last longer and sound better, protecting the vinyl collection you've already invested in.
Straight Tonearm
A straight tonearm keeps the playback angle consistent from the outer groove to the inner, reducing distortion and easier to set up than curved designs, no fine calibration required to start enjoying your collection.
MM Cartridge with Diamond Stylus
Pre-installed and ready to play: the AT3600L moving-magnet cartridge with a diamond stylus delivers stable tracking and
balanced tone straight out of the box. No separate cartridge purchase or install needed on day one and no dead end if you want to upgrade later.

Technical specifications
| Type | Fully manual belt drive turntable |
| Speeds | 33-1/3 & 45 RPM |
| Cartridge & stylus | Replaceable Audio-Technica AT3600L |
| Platter / construction | High-density clear acrylic platter |
| Connectivity | Bluetooth 5.3 output |
| Output | RCA & Bluetooth® wireless streaming |
| Dimensions | Lid Closed: 420mm*340mm*95mm / Lid Open: 420mm*340mm*380mm |
| Recommended Tracking Force | 3.5 ± 0.5g |
| Auto Stop | Yes (The tonearm won’t auto lift or return, the platter stops and the arm only raises slightly.) |

You can connect directly to powered speakers or active bookshelf speakers right out of the box.
If you already own a dedicated hi-fi setup, you can also switch between Line and Phono mode for compatibility with external preamps and amplifiers.
The ICE1-V2 uses Bluetooth 5.3 with aptX HD technology for low-latency, high-resolution wireless playback.
For everyday listening, Bluetooth audio remains clear, stable, and highly detailed when paired with compatible speakers or headphones.
For the purest analog listening experience, RCA wired output is also available.
Acrylic helps reduce unwanted resonance and vibration during playback, resulting in cleaner and more stable sound performance.
Compared to lower-cost ABS plastic designs, the ICE1-V2’s full acrylic construction provides:
- Tighter bass response
- Improved midrange clarity
- Reduced mechanical vibration
This type of material is commonly used in higher-end turntables for improved acoustic stability.
Yes. The ICE1-V2 uses a standard cartridge mount, making future upgrades simple and flexible.
It is compatible with many popular cartridge brands, including Audio-Technica and Ortofon, allowing you to improve your sound setup as your vinyl collection grows.
The ICE1-V2 supports both 33⅓ RPM and 45 RPM playback speeds, covering the vast majority of modern vinyl records, including:
7-inch singles
10-inch records
12-inch LPs
Please note that 78 RPM shellac records are not supported.
